Subversion Repositories HelenOS

Rev

Rev 3577 |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 3577 Rev 3581
Line 182... Line 182...
182
            else
182
            else
183
                active_read_key_pressed(x);
183
                active_read_key_pressed(x);
184
        }
184
        }
185
#else
185
#else
186
    extern chardev_t kbrd;
186
        extern chardev_t kbrd;
187
    if(x!=0x0d)
187
        if(x != 0x0d) {
188
    {
188
            if(x == 0x7f)
189
        if(x==0x7f) x='\b';
189
                x = '\b';
190
        chardev_push_character(&kbrd,x);
190
             chardev_push_character(&kbrd, x);
191
    }    
191
        }    
192
#endif      
192
#endif      
193
 
193
 
194
    }
194
    }
Line 232... Line 232...
232
            else
232
            else
233
                key_pressed(x);
233
                key_pressed(x);
234
        }
234
        }
235
#else
235
#else
236
    extern chardev_t kbrd;
236
        extern chardev_t kbrd;
237
    if(x!=0x0d)
237
        if(x != 0x0d) {
238
    {
238
            if (x == 0x7f)
239
        if(x==0x7f) x='\b';
239
                x = '\b';
240
        chardev_push_character(&kbrd,x);
240
            chardev_push_character(&kbrd, x);
241
    }    
241
        }    
242
#endif      
242
#endif      
243
 
243
 
244
    }
244
    }